The variety is a compact, well-branched shrub with a rounded crown, the height of which varies from 40 to 70 cm. The plant is suitable for planting in pots, on terraces, balconies, and in the open field in sunny locations.
The flowers are bright red, double, with soft velvety petals, reach 6–8 cm in diameter, and have a delicate berry fragrance. The stems are upright, short, and most often bear a single flower.
The variety is repeat-flowering; flowering continues from spring to late autumn. The plant is characterized by high resistance to powdery mildew and black spot, as well as winter hardiness down to -18 °C.
